在 root 用户下, 执行
- [root@localhost GitLab]# sudo GitLab-Rails console production
- -------------------------------------------------------------------------------------
- GitLab: 11.7.3 (3424476)
- GitLab Shell: 8.4.4
- PostgreSQL: 9.6.11
- -------------------------------------------------------------------------------------
- Loading production environment (Rails 5.0.7.1)
2. 获得用户数据, 修改用户密码
- irb(main):001:0> u=User.where(id:1).first
- => #<User id:1 @root>
- irb(main):003:0> u.password=12345678
- => 12345678
- irb(main):004:0> u.password_confirmation=12345678
- => 12345678
- irb(main):005:0> u.save!
- Enqueued ActionMailer::DeliveryJob (Job ID: 15c3c8de-e839-4874-8104-d72dbe224756) to Sidekiq(mailers) with arguments: "DeviseMailer", "password_change", "deliver_now", #<GlobalID:0x00007f65d5b944d8 @uri=#<URI::GID gid://GitLab/User/1>>
- => true
- irb(main):006:0> quit
另: GitLab 默认用户名密码 root 5ivel!fe
来源: http://www.bubuko.com/infodetail-2945378.html